Technical Deep Dive: Foam Padding And Comfort Design

If a component can change your lead time, it must be locked early. Examples: custom hardware, coated fabrics, electronics modules, and specialty zippers. We track these as “critical path items” and set cut-off dates to prevent slip.

Your factory needs a written spec it can follow: measurement tolerances, seam allowances, stitch density, reinforcement mapping, and edge finishing rules. Without these, every batch becomes a “new prototype”.

Quality Assurance & Timeline

Crowdfunding timelines are credibility. The schedule below is a factory-ready way to plan prototypes, PP approval, and final AQL so you can communicate dates to backers with confidence.

Phase What happens Typical time
Tech pack review Lock claims, BOM, key measurements, and test methods 5 days
Prototype build Round 1–5 sampling, fit + feature validation 10 days / round
PP sample Pre-production sample with final materials and QC standard 8 days
Mass production Line setup, in-line inspection, AQL final QC 7–9 weeks
Packing & shipment Carton optimization + labeling + DDP planning 24 days

Costing Model (Transparent, Not Guesswork)

Instead of quoting a single number, build a model around the BOM. Planning example: EXW 38 + packaging 9 + QC 4 + freight 12 ≈ landed 63. If your target retail is 129, this quickly validates margin.

BOM Line Item Est. Cost Weight
Shell fabric $9 21%
Lining + pockets $4 9%
Zippers (waterproof/standard) $3 7%
Hardware (buckles, rings, pulls) $4 9%
Webbing + binding $2 5%
Padding (EVA/foam) + structure $8 19%
Branding (print/patch/labels) $2 5%
Labor + line overhead $11 26%
Total (example) $43 100%
